 Biradial symmetry and lack of cnidoblasts are the characteristics of [CBSE AIPMT 2006]

(a) Starfish and sea anemone

(b) Ctenoplana and Beroe

(c) Aurelia and Paramecium

(d) Hydra and starfish

Answer/Explanation

Ans. (b)

Ctenoplana and Beroe lack cnidoblasts and have biradial symmetry. These belong to phylum-Ctenophora.
Hydra, sea anemone and Aurelia are coelenterates which have cnidoblasts. Although sea anemone has biradial symmetry.
